Gaza Flotila Mission: Was allegedly Hamas operative plan to a unsuccessful journey of Gita Thunberg? The report claims that Zahar Birvi was the main organizer

A British-Pilstinian journalist alleged a long-standing relationship with Hamas, allegedly played a leading role in launching a support ship carrying climate activist Gita Thunberg and others, before it was intercepted by the Israeli forces.According to a report by The Telegraph, Jahar Birvi was involved in The Madelleen’s high-profile launch, aimed at challenging the naval blockade of Israeli’s Gaza. The ship flagged off on 1 June under the banner of Freedom Floral alliance, with 12 international activists, including Thunberg.The Birvi is the head of the International Committee who is the founding member of the breaking of siege on Gaza and the Freedom Flotila alliance. He was present on Madeline’s departure and praised them for his courage in an attempt to assist Palestinian citizens. The mission included supplies like staple food items such as baby formula and rice.The Israeli army detained the ship, which Birvi described as “a stolen operation in international water and 150 nautical miles from Palestinian water”. “The Freedom Flag Alliance demands international intervention to ensure its safety and release,” he said.Although Birvi has denied any participation in terrorist activities, it has been the subject of long -standing allegations. In 2013, Israel gave him a label of Hamas Operative located in Europe. His non-profit, European Forum, which supports Palestinian rights, was named a terrorist organization in 2021 by Israeli officials.The 2012 photo of Birvi, who attended an event with former Hamas political head Ismail Honeyh, is often quoted as evidence of his alleged link. However, Birvi has constantly maintained his innocence. He said, “My legal team mainly trusted the fact that there has never been any legal punishment against me by any official authority in any state in any state anywhere in the world, and that I have never been found involved in any illegal acts, which can be understood under the purview of terrorism crimes,” he said that after listing a terrorism from Natwest.Recently, Labor MP Christian Wakeford used parliamentary privilege to labeled Birvi to “a serious national security risk” and accused of “British citizenship” through the use of “fake documents” after the Hamas -led attack on Israel on 7 October 2023. Birvi dismissed the allegations as “uneven”.Neither the United Kingdom nor the United States, which both listed both Hamas as a terrorist organization, have taken legal action against Birvi. The European Forum has also rejected the claims of terrorist connections, arguing that it is being incorrectly targeted for its advocacy work.Birvi Gaza remains an outspoken critic of Israeli policies and has led several demonstrations in London. He also condemned the Israeli defense forces to seize Madelleen and continued to call for international pressure to eliminate the blockade on the Gaza Strip, which has been in place since Hamas was under control in 2007.
